SIU KIU LAM et al., Plaintiffs, v. NELLY LOO, M.D., et al., Defendants. MORELLI LAW FIRM, PLLC, Nonparty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ided November 1, 2017.


Ordered that the order is affirmed, without costs or disbursements.

Contrary to its contention, the nonparty-appellant law firm (hereinafter the law firm) failed to demonstrate that its statutory compensation in the sum of $376,198.50 under the Judiciary Law § 474-a (2) schedule was inadequate.
